  • The origin of Cyclone "Asani" has been recorded in the Bay of Bengal.
  • The name 'Asani' has been given by Sri Lanka that means ‘wrath’ in Sinhalese.
  • Cyclone 'Asani' is the first storm in the North Indian Ocean region in 2022.
  • The cyclone has been predicted strengthen into a very severe cyclonic storm, with wind speeds reaching 118 to 220 km/hour, and remain over east-central Bay of Bengal.
